summ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authoréclairevoyant2023-04-27 12:42:51 -0400
committeréclairevoyant2023-04-27 12:42:51 -0400
commit9b954fb24134df5ed2af6f629290a2602eb4e9a4 (patch)
tree68cdd8101b9d570c0078842cd3106b970d0b38f4
parentfe4799252c876fc18481257e2db087380f033053 (diff)
downloadaur-9b954fb24134df5ed2af6f629290a2602eb4e9a4.tar.gz
neovim-git: clean up lpeg issue (see neovim/neovim#23216)
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D9
2 files changed, 6 insertions, 5 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 4f22c71be158..cd9b205bf33b 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,6 @@
pkgbase = neovim-git
pkgdesc = Fork of Vim aiming to improve user experience, plugins, and GUIs.
- pkgver = 0.9.0.r263.gdbcd1985d1
+ pkgver = 0.9.0.r362.geb4676c67f
pkgrel = 1
url = https://neovim.io
install = neovim-git.install
diff --git a/PKGBUILD b/PKGBUILD
index 8a106539e0db..4899b205a1d8 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-5,7 +5,7 @@
_pkgname=neovim
pkgname="$_pkgname-git"
-pkgver=0.9.0.r263.gdbcd1985d1
+pkgver=0.9.0.r362.geb4676c67f
pkgrel=1
pkgdesc='Fork of Vim aiming to improve user experience, plugins, and GUIs.'
arch=(i686 x86_64 armv7h armv6h aarch64)
@@ -40,6 +40,8 @@ build() {
-GNinja \
-DCMAKE_BUILD_TYPE=RelWithDebInfo \
-DCMAKE_INSTALL_PREFIX=/usr
+
+ sed -i 's|-llpeg|/usr/lib/lua/5.1/lpeg.so|g' build/build.ninja
cmake --build build
}
@@ -53,10 +55,9 @@ package() {
install -Dm644 $pkgname-sysinit.vim "$pkgdir/etc/xdg/nvim/sysinit.vim"
install -Dm644 $pkgname-archlinux.vim "$pkgdir/usr/share/nvim/archlinux.vim"
- cd build
- DESTDIR="$pkgdir" cmake --build . --target install
+ DESTDIR="$pkgdir" cmake --install build
- cd ../$_pkgname
+ cd $_pkgname
install -Dm644 LICENSE.txt "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
install -Dm644 runtime/nvim.desktop -t "$pkgdir/usr/share/applications/"
install -Dm644 runtime/nvim.appdata.xml -t "$pkgdir/usr/share/metainfo/"